Transaction 74627e24fcdd32be0451274fde16f98cedffef7aa34a1348329bcb09bae56ce0

2 Input
2 Outputs
  • 74627e24fcdd32be0451274fde16f98cedffef7aa34a1348329bcb09bae56ce0:0
  • value  1016437
    address  1K64EN9SUCK8m7gXp2Z94kU2XGNFZMd3vr
  • 74627e24fcdd32be0451274fde16f98cedffef7aa34a1348329bcb09bae56ce0:1
  • value  16000000
    address  39iWbHtu6LNMerYRkFZhmYUThAKP38K8Z4